Q1: [25 marks]
A classroom has the dimensions of 10 m long, 8 m wide and 6 m high and an open window of 1.5 m long and 2 m high. A methanol bottle breaks to form a \(2-\mathrm{m}\) diameter pool fire. The initial room temperature is \(20^{\circ}\mathrm{C}\), and the heat of combustion of methanol or wood is \(22\mathrm{MJ}/\mathrm{kg}\),
(a) What is the heat release rate of the pool fire?
(5 marks)
(b) Can this pool fire always trigger the heat detector (RTI \(=120\mathrm{~m}^{1/\mathrm{s}^{1/2}}\)) with a threshold temperature of \(65^{\circ}\mathrm{C}\)?
(6 marks)
(c) If this fire is 1 m away from the detector, how long it triggers the heat detector? (7 marks)
(d) If there are twenty \(25-\mathrm{kg}\) sofas in the room, and flashover occurs in 5 min , what is the total burning duration?
(7 marks)
